X-Git-Url: https://git.deb.at/w?p=deb%2Fmoinmoin.git;a=blobdiff_plain;f=theme%2Fdebwiki.py;h=5ef31e91a7596729d9ba3859c0457c3134be653d;hp=5529bb30c7e3f1f148198e58c1b7b978cd65abda;hb=261f73f13a095f4b744b826b107bdb51fc23c96c;hpb=f5041d6a290ec7ef657e9e24333ca1c80c08d72e diff --git a/theme/debwiki.py b/theme/debwiki.py index 5529bb3..5ef31e9 100644 --- a/theme/debwiki.py +++ b/theme/debwiki.py @@ -1,10 +1,9 @@ # -*- coding: iso-8859-1 -*- """ - MoinMoin - Debian theme + MoinMoin - modern theme @copyright: 2003-2005 Nir Soffer, Thomas Waldmann @license: GNU GPL, see COPYING for details. - theme modified by Kalle Soderman """ from MoinMoin.theme import ThemeBase @@ -92,28 +91,27 @@ class Theme(ThemeBase): # Header u'', # Post header custom html (not recommended) @@ -138,7 +136,7 @@ class Theme(ThemeBase): # Header u'', @@ -162,7 +160,6 @@ class Theme(ThemeBase): page = d['page'] html = [ # End of page - self.pageinfo(page), self.endPage(), # Pre footer custom html (not recommended!) @@ -170,7 +167,8 @@ class Theme(ThemeBase): # Footer u'', @@ -180,39 +178,6 @@ class Theme(ThemeBase): ] return u'\n'.join(html) - def title(self, d): - """ Assemble the title (now using breadcrumbs) - - @param d: parameter dictionary - @rtype: string - @return: title html - """ - _ = self.request.getText - content = [] - if d['title_text'] == d['page'].split_title(): # just showing a page, no action - curpage = '' - segments = d['page_name'].split('/') # was: title_text - for s in segments[:-1]: - curpage += s - content.append(Page(self.request, curpage).link_to(self.request, s)) - curpage += '/' - link_text = segments[-1] - link_title = _('Click to do a full-text search for this title') - link_query = { - 'action': 'fullsearch', - 'value': 'linkto:"%s"' % d['page_name'], - 'context': '180', - } - # we dont use d['title_link'] any more, but make it ourselves: - link = d['page'].link_to(self.request, link_text, querystr=link_query, title=link_title, css_class='backlink', rel='nofollow') - content.append(link) - else: - content.append(wikiutil.escape(d['title_text'])) - - location_html = u'/'.join(content) - html = u'%s' % location_html - return html - def username(self, d): """ Assemble the username / userprefs link @@ -293,7 +258,7 @@ class Theme(ThemeBase): title = self.shortenPagename(title) link = page.link_to(request, title) items.append(link) - html = u'
%s
' % u'/'.join(items) + html = u'
%s
'% u'/'.join(items) return html def interwiki(self, d):